Dshackle provides a high level aggregated API on top of several underlying upstreams.
I.e. to blockchain nodes such as Bitcoind, Geth, Parity, or providers like Infura, and so on.
It automatically verifies their availability and the current status of the network, executes commands making sure that the response is consistent and/or data successfully broadcasted to the network.

==== Ethereum
- Most of Ethereum nodes support WebSocket connection, in addition to the JSON RPC.
If it's available on your node, it's suggested to configure both JSON RPC and WebSocket connection
==== Bitcoin
- Bitcoind needs to be configured to index/track addresses that you're going to request.
Make sure you configure it to index your addresses with `importaddress`.
If you request balance for an address that is not indexed then it returns 0 balance.
- To track all transactions you need to setup index for transactions, which is disabled by default.
Run it with `-reindex` option, or set `txindex=1` in the config.

Dshackle provides an enhanced and unified API based on HTTP2, gRPC and Protobuf.
It works in addition to JSON RPC proxy and can be used separately.
Clients can be generated for all major programming languages, and there're official libraries for Java and Javascript.
NOTE: It's not necessary to use gRPC, as Dshackle can provide standard JSON RPC proxy, but Dshackle gRPC interface improves performance and provides additional features.
